Stampede Spirit at Your Doorstep: A Welcoming Tradition for Newcomer Families

Western hospitality rolled into the heart of our neighbourhoods!

This June, over 100 newcomers across Calgary experienced a true taste of western hospitality — right in their own communities — thanks to the Stampede Neighbourhood Pop-Ups, a heartwarming collaboration between Immigrant Services Calgary and the Calgary Stampede.

What began during the COVID-19 pandemic as a creative way to connect and bring joy to newcomer families has now become an annual tradition. This initiative brings the Stampede spirit — complete with horses, mascots, volunteers, and Stampede royalty — to families who may be experiencing this iconic Calgary event for the very first time.

Building Community, One Pop-Up at a Time

At each pop-up, children laughed, families smiled, and new neighbours connected. Beyond the cowboy hats and rodeo flair, the real magic was in the sense of belonging. These visits aren’t just entertaining — they’re a powerful gesture of inclusion.

Through these pop-ups, newcomers are introduced not only to a beloved Calgary tradition but to the community spirit that defines our city.

"I never imagined seeing horses and Stampede royalty in our neighbourhood!" said one newcomer parent. "My kids were so excited — it made us feel truly welcome in Calgary."

Why It Matters

For many families new to Canada, these events are more than just a fun experience. They offer:

  • A chance to participate in local culture
  • An opportunity to connect with neighbours and community members
  • A moment of joy and celebration during the often-stressful transition to a new country
  • A way to connect with Canadian traditions
  • A welcoming reminder that they belong here
